CARS Tour heading to Georgia, Dale Jr to compete

Series making first trip to the Peach State since relaunch in 2015

For the first time since the zMAX CARS Tour was relaunched in 2015, the series is heading to the Peach State.

The zMAX CARS Tour will race at the Cordele Motor Speedway in Georgia on Saturday, April 12 and series co-owner Dale Earnhardt, Jr. will compete in the event.  Both the Late Model Stock and Pro Late Model tours will be in action in the first race in the Peach State.

The Late Model Stock portion will feature $2500 to start to incentivize travel.

“It’s exciting to have the chance to take the zMAX CARS Tour to Cordele,” Earnhardt, Jr. said in a series press release. “Fans in the area have expressed excitement about this race being added to the schedule. Our teams are looking forward to this new challenge. I’m thrilled to add it to the short list of events I’ll be racing in next year.”

Cordele Motor Speedway, formerly known as Watermelon Capital Speedway, was purchased by Greg Nolan in 2023.  Nolan and his staff have worked hard to restore the track to its former glory.

“I just bought the track at the end of last year,” Nolan said. “We’ve completely remodeled the track. It’s a lot nicer than it was prior and everyone says they love it. My son used to drive on [Cordele] all the time, so I wanted to keep [this place running], especially since its one of the last circle tracks in Georgia.”

Cordele Motor Speedway general manager Ricky Brooks, who also heads up the UARA National Super Late Model races, is equally excited to bring the CARS Tour to the south.

“It’s been all positive,” Brooks said. “The race track and area needs some energy the CARS Tour can bring. The pits have grown pretty fast, but we’re still working on the grandstands a little bit. I think the CARS Tour will bring more people [to Cordele] and hopefully they’ll stay as customers throughout the year.”

Nolan said he hopes to bring the series back each season.

The inaugural CARS Tour race at Cordele Motor Speedway will be broadcast on FloRacing, which is the exclusive streaming partner of the zMAX CARS Tour.
